Zaydis do not insult the Sahabah, and while saying that Ali should have khaliifa, do not insult Abu bakr or Cumar. They also do not believe in these fairy tale of tahriif of the quraan, nor the other absurdities found in 12ers theology.

They are still mutazli though, which means they are still deviant. But they are the best of the shiicas
